Sharing our expertise on specialised management of sexual offenders

QCS is committed to proactively engaging and working with our law-enforcement colleagues across the country to identify and share appropriate information and prevent and disrupt crime.

As recognised leaders in specialised sexual offending clinical services, QCS was invited to deliver a suite of training to our colleagues from New South Wales Corrective Services.

The ‘Static, Stable and Acute’ suite of sex offenders tools is a niche suite of training materials, with only 100 accredited trainers worldwide – a number of these trainers are employed by QCS.

Four QCS officers travelled to New South Wales to deliver multiple training sessions to around 120 staff at the Brush Farm Academy in Sydney.
